Wild strawberries, pretty spring flowers, lavender, and Provençal garrigue notes all emerge from the 2022 Châteauneuf Du Pape La Begude Des Papes, a beautifully balanced, elegant, perfumed, seductive 2022 that will put a smile on your face over the coming decade or so. The blend is 70% Grenache, 15% Syrah, and 15% Mourvèdre, and it was brought up in 20% new barrels, with the balance in demi-muids and used barrels.
A blend of 70% Grenache Noir, 15% Syrah and 15% Mourvèdre sourced from vines planted on the southern sector of the appellation on sandy, calcareous and galets roulés soils, the 2022 Chateauneuf du Pape La Begude des Papes reveals a floral, spicy bouquet of rose, dark cherries, licorice, bay leaf and dark wild berries. Medium to full-bodied, enrobing and fleshy, it's layered and structured with velvety tannins, bright acids and a long, penetrating finish. Offering plenty of immediate appeal, this wine also possesses the structural backbone necessary for graceful aging.
70% Grenache, 15% Syrah and 15% Mourvèdre. Vinified in concrete tanks. Aged in a mixture of demi-muids (20%), new oak barrels (20%), old oak barrels (10%) and truncated tanks (50%). Tasted blind. Ripe red fruits and spiced nose. The palate is sleek, powerful and dense, with a real richness and energy as well. Already appealing and approachable – a crowd-pleasing, generous style. (AC)
